I was wondering how and what the rates are that a 3rd party billing company typically charge (what is the industry average)?

Do they charge a percentage of receipts (money collected)? If so, does the rate differ from reimbursements from insurance companies and private pay patients?

Often it encompasses how busy the service is, what the current collection percentage is, etc, then if you use their equipment etc. They then establish a quote usually a certain percentage of what they collect. Expect to pay about 8-12% of collections but keep in mind most of the times the amount collected will go up. For example one service I am aware of used to collect about $10000 per month doing billing collecting on their own. They started using a third party billing service that provided laptops with run report software and within a couple of months the service was getting about $25000 a month after the billing company took their cut.

Now there are also billing only services that charge a smaller percentage but they basically do not do anything but mail a bill or file for insurance. They usually take a 3-6% of what comes in but you will not see much more coming in than if you were doing the same in house.
